Members of Montenegro's army continue providing assistance to flood-stricken Serbia

Published on: May 21, 2014 • 5:09 PM Author: PR Bureau
Podgorica, Montenegro (21 May 2014) – Members of Montenegro's army continued their activities in providing assistance to flood-stricken areas in Serbia.
Hand-in hand with units of the Serbian Ministry of the Interiors, they were engaged in delivering food, water, medical equipment and medicine, as well as in evacuating the remaining residents of the villages in the Obrenovac municipality.
Serbia’s Defence Minister Bratislav Gašić visited Obrenovac Crisis HQ and talked with members of the Montenegrin army. He expressed his sincere gratitude for the sacrifice the Montenegrin soldiers made during the evacuation and medical aid provision to the endangered population.
